The Australian government has initiated a A$2 billion (approximately US$1.3 billion) lawsuit against US-based multinational 3M, focusing on contamination at defence sites. According to the BBC report, the case is the largest ever brought by the Australian government and concerns alleged environmental damage from per- and polyfluoroalkyl substances (PFAS), often called "forever chemicals" due to their persistence in the environment and human body. The legal action specifically targets 3M’s firefighting foams used at Australian defence facilities. PFAS have been linked to various health risks, including cancer and immune system effects, though scientific consensus continues to evolve. The A$2 billion claim seeks to recover the costs of cleaning up contaminated sites and compensating for environmental harm. The lawsuit represents a significant escalation in government-led action against PFAS contamination, with Australia joining other nations and jurisdictions pursuing legal redress against chemical manufacturers. The Australian lawsuit, being the largest government-initiated case, could potentially set a precedent for similar actions in other regions. For 3M, the A$2 billion figure, if awarded, would represent a material liability, though the outcome of the litigation remains uncertain. The case underscores the growing regulatory and legal scrutiny of PFAS, which has led to increased cleanup costs and litigation expenses for chemical producers. Market observers might anticipate that other governments could follow Australia’s lead, potentially expanding 3M’s legal burden. Additionally, the focus on defence sites highlights potential future claims from military installations worldwide that have used PFAS-containing foams. The Australian government’s decision to pursue the largest lawsuit in its history signals a determined stance on environmental accountability. Investors may monitor the progress of the case, as an adverse outcome could require significant provisions for cleanup costs and damages. However, legal processes are inherently lengthy and outcomes uncertain. Broader implications for the chemical industry may include increased regulatory costs and potential liabilities for other PFAS producers. Without a definitive court ruling, the near-term impact on 3M’s stock price is likely to be driven by market sentiment and additional developments in the PFAS litigation landscape. The case also highlights a trend towards government-led environmental enforcement, which could affect other companies with similar product portfolios. While 3M has previously settled some PFAS claims, the scale of this Australian lawsuit suggests that the total financial exposure from PFAS litigation remains difficult to quantify.
